CSS完成游戲界面模式
CSS是網頁設計中必不可少的部分,它可以讓網頁看起來更加美觀、清晰,也可以通過它實現各種復雜的功能。其中,CSS完成游戲界面模式是一種非常流行的應用。下面,我們來看一下如何通過CSS完成游戲界面模式。
/* 設置游戲界面樣式 */ .game-board { display: flex; flex-wrap: wrap; width: 300px; height: 300px; border: 2px solid #333; } /* 設置方塊樣式 */ .square { width: calc(100% / 3); height: calc(100% / 3); background-color: #fff; border: 1px solid #333; font-size: 48px; text-align: center; line-height: calc((100% / 3) - 2px); box-sizing: border-box; } /* 設置游戲狀態樣式 */ .game-status { margin-top: 20px; font-size: 24px; text-align: center; } /* 鼠標懸停方塊樣式 */ .square:hover { background-color: #ddd; }
在上面的代碼中,.game-board表示游戲界面的樣式,通過設置display:flex和flex-wrap:wrap可以實現游戲方塊的自動換行。.square表示方塊的樣式,通過設置width和height可以控制方塊大小,通過設置background-color和border可以實現方塊底色和邊框。.game-status表示游戲狀態的樣式,通過設置margin-top可以控制游戲狀態的位置,通過設置font-size和text-align可以實現游戲狀態的字體大小和對齊方式。.square:hover表示鼠標懸停方塊的樣式,通過設置background-color可以實現方塊背景色變化。
通過上述CSS樣式設置,我們完成了一個簡單的井字棋游戲界面。在實際游戲開發中,我們可以根據游戲需求進行相應的樣式設置,讓游戲界面更加美觀、清晰。
上一篇css定義圓形圖片框
下一篇css布局 中間怎么寫